Quick Start Guide

To begin using your Guangdong K3 gaming headset, ensure it is fully charged. Connect the device using either the 2.4G wireless dongle or Bluetooth. The headset supports PC, PS4, PS5, Switch, and mobile devices.

Connection Instructions

2.4G Wireless Connection:

  1. Plug the 2.4G dongle into the USB port of your computer or console.
  2. The headset will automatically connect. The status light will remain green once connected.
  3. If using the Type-C transmitter, insert it into the phone/device; the headset will connect automatically.

Bluetooth Connection:

  1. In shutdown state, press and hold the power button for 5 seconds to enter pairing mode.
  2. The status light will flash, indicating it is ready to pair.
  3. Select the headset from your device's Bluetooth menu.

Operation Instructions

The headset controls are managed via the buttons on the earcups:

  • 2.4G/BT Switching: Click to switch between 2.4G and Bluetooth modes.
  • 7.1 Sound/Lights: Click to toggle 7.1 sound or effect lights.
  • Power On/Off: Long press for 3 seconds.
  • Play/Pause: Click the power button.
  • Volume Control: Use the Volume+/Volume- buttons.
  • Microphone: Use the dedicated mute button or the built-in/external microphone.

Specifications

  • Wireless Version: V5.3
  • Speaker Size: 50mm
  • Frequency Response: 20Hz to 20kHz
  • Battery Capacity: 3.7V 1000mAh
  • Charging Time: About 2.5 hours
  • Music Playing Time: >40 hours (Lights off)
  • Charging Interface: USB-C
  • Communication Distance: >10 meters

Troubleshooting

If you encounter issues, check the following:

  • Pairing Failure: Ensure the headset is in pairing mode and within range.
  • Audio Interference: Check for other wireless devices causing interference.
  • Low Battery: If the headset shuts down or has a low battery warning, charge it immediately.

Safety and Battery

Use only the specified charging method. Do not dispose of the battery in fire or heat. Avoid using the headset at high volumes for long periods to prevent hearing damage.
